Had my driveway and garage done. After one winter this is how my new driveway looked like. Tried to call Jesus and he never picked up or called me back. Very disappointed. Would not use again. And no, I do not use any salt products as I know it is damaging to concrete.

Stay clear of this company. We gave Jesus a deposit and signed a contract last November for a complete removal and paving of our driveway, after he was a subcontractor installing my garage floor. The floor drain backed up in dec and January Jesus never came out or tried to fix it. Once April came he had excuse after excuse why he couldn't come out to fix the drain or pave the driveway. Finally he removed the old driveway then no response and broken dates to finish. He then asked for $1500 to get the apron and drain done then ghosted us for weeks until he came out and pulled the concrete and fixed the drain. Weeks again and no replies except for broken promises. Finally he came out and put the apron in and cleaned up the tons of concrete he left blocked my driveway. Finally after texts of voiding the contract he dropped off gravel, damaging my neighbors fence, and a promise to finish the driveway in a week. That week came and gone. Ended up hiring someone else. Jesus said he wanted to resolve the refund but hasn't responded for over a week. So end of story J &F has $4300 of our dollars and did not do thier job, avoids calls and texts, breaks promise dates and is a thief. Do not do business with these guys or Jesus Martinez

2025 Update: I'm leaving my original review below because I'm still grateful for the work that was done. Unfortunately, I've had to change my stars because there have been some concrete quality issues. I don't know if it was Ozinga's fault (there was a strike going on at the plant, if I recall correctly) or J&F's mixing or the fact that it sprinkled the afternoon of the installation, but we've had some spalling on the walkway from the garage to the house. The rest of the concrete is in good condition. I've added images below. Despite reaching out J&F multiple times, and despite reassurances that they would fix it, they never showed to repair their work or make good on those promises. ----- 2023 Post J&F Hardscapes took out our old walkway and driveway. They graded the yard, poured a new concrete walkway and driveway, and installed sod in the yard. We made some changes along the way and discovered a few surprises (a cistern!). At every step, they worked with us. They even gave us a quote to fill in the cistern after we discovered it. They did that for us too! They will get the job done. We're happy with how it all turned out.
